Manigod ski resort is located in the French Alps, specifically in the Aravis Range. The resort is situated at the foot of the famous La Tournette mountain, which is the highest peak in the area at 2,351 meters (7,713 feet) above sea level. The surrounding mountains provide stunning views and a variety of terrain for skiing and snowboarding.
The resort boasts some of the best beginner and intermediate skiing trails in the region, with well-groomed slopes and stunning alpine scenery.
